Ethereum rallies past $2,000 on regulatory optimism and ETF inflows

Ethereum climbed 27% in seven days after breaking above $2,000, driven by positive regulatory signals, Treasury liquidity plans and institutional buying via ETFs.

· +6

Ethereum surged 27% over seven days after moving above the $2,000 level, with the breakout triggering substantial short liquidations that amplified the upward momentum. The rally coincided with shifting market sentiment on the regulatory front.

The Securities and Exchange Commission's proposed framework for crypto assets offered projects more flexibility in fundraising without following traditional securities-listing procedures. Separately, the Treasury Department announced plans to double its bond buyback programme beginning in September, injecting additional liquidity into financial markets and supporting risk-sensitive assets including cryptocurrencies.

Institutional demand strengthened alongside price recovery. Ethereum-linked exchange-traded funds attracted more than $1.2 billion during August, marking their strongest monthly inflow since August 2025 when Ethereum traded near its previous record high. The Crypto Fear and Greed Index shifted sharply from below 40, signalling fear, to 80 representing extreme greed—its highest reading since December 2024. On-chain volume patterns have narrowed, with a crossover in the seven-day and 30-day trading volume averages yet to occur, a signal that would further confirm the improving outlook.
